首页 > 关键词专题列表 > 事件驱动相关
事件驱动

无论您是学生、教育工作者、企业家还是普通用户,脚本大全都适合您。通过浏览我们的事件驱动专题,您将获得与之相关的一切信息,包括定义、解释、应用领域、案例研究等。我们深入探讨每个事件驱动,并提供相关教程和链接,以帮助您进一步了解和学习。

  • C++ 中事件驱动的编程如何处理并发问题?
    C++ 中事件驱动的编程如何处理并发问题?
    C++ 事件驱动的编程中的并发问题处理需要关注数据竞争、死锁和优先级反转等问题。解决方法包括:1. 互斥体和锁定防止数据竞争;2. 条件变量用于线程间同步;3. 原子操作确保共享变量的操作是不可分割的。C++ 中事件驱动的编程中的并发问题处理事件驱动的编程 (EDP) 依赖于事件循环来处理传入事件,
    并发 事件驱动
    179 2024-06-08
  • C++ 函数在并发编程中的事件驱动机制?
    C++ 函数在并发编程中的事件驱动机制?
    并发编程中的事件驱动机制通过在事件发生时执行回调函数来响应外部事件。在 C++ 中,事件驱动机制可用函数指针实现:函数指针可以注册回调函数,在事件发生时执行。lambda 表达式也可以实现事件回调,允许创建匿名函数对象。实战案例使用函数指针实现 GUI 按钮点击事件,在事件发生时调用回调函数并打印消
    并发编程 事件驱动
    474 2024-06-08
  • C++ 中的事件驱动编程如何提高软件可伸缩性和性能?
    C++ 中的事件驱动编程如何提高软件可伸缩性和性能?
    EDP 在 C++ 中通过回调函数提高软件可伸缩性和性能:EDP 响应特定事件发生的回调函数。回调函数使应用程序在不繁忙等待的情况下响应事件。EDP 使用异步 I/O 操作,释放主线程并提高整体响应能力。非阻塞操作避免应用程序挂起,即使处理大量 I/O 请求也是如此。并行性允许应用程序同时处理多个事
    事件驱动 软件可伸缩性
    161 2024-06-06
  • C++ 中的事件驱动编程如何用于实时系统开发?
    C++ 中的事件驱动编程如何用于实时系统开发?
    C++ 中事件驱动编程 (EDP) 可通过回调函数或事件监听器实现,在实时系统开发中非常有用,因为它允许应用程序对外部事件快速响应。 1. 使用回调函数:程序员注册回调函数,当特定事件发生时调用该函数。 2. 使用事件监听器:事件监听器监听特定类型的事件并做出响应。 3. 实战应用:EDP 用于中断
    事件驱动 实时系统
    201 2024-06-04
  • 使用Java函数和无服务器架构实现事件驱动的系统
    使用Java函数和无服务器架构实现事件驱动的系统
    利用 Java 函数和无服务器架构构建事件驱动的系统:使用 Java 函数:高度可伸缩、易于部署,管理成本低。无服务器架构:按使用付费模式,消除基础设施成本和管理负担。实战案例:创建事件驱动的警报系统,通过 Java 函数响应 SNS 主题事件,发送电子邮件警报。使用 Java 函数和无服务器架构实
    事件驱动 无服务器架构
    465 2024-05-15
  • Java 函数在事件驱动的架构中的作用和优势是什么?
    Java 函数在事件驱动的架构中的作用和优势是什么?
    在事件驱动的架构中,Java 函数扮演着使用无服务器代码响应事件并执行业务逻辑的重要角色。其优势包括:无服务器执行,无需管理基础设施。按需扩展,根据需求自动处理负载。松散耦合,提高可维护性。快速开发,加快交付速度。Java 函数在事件驱动的架构中的作用和优势在事件驱动的架构中,Java 函数扮演着重
    java 事件驱动
    411 2024-04-30
  • 掌握Python异步编程技巧,成为高级异步编程者
    掌握Python异步编程技巧,成为高级异步编程者
    1.什么是Python异步编程? python异步编程是一种通过协程和事件驱动来实现并发和高性能的编程技术。协程是一种允许一个函数在暂停后继续执行的函数。当一个协程被暂停时,它的状态和局部变量都会被保存起来,以便在它被再次调用时恢复执行。事件驱动是一种响应事件的编程方式。在事件驱动的程序中,当一个事
    Python 并发 协程 异步编程 高性能 事件驱动
    255 2024-03-29
  • 使用ThinkPHP6实现基于事件的编程
    使用ThinkPHP6实现基于事件的编程
    随着互联网行业的发展,事件驱动编程越来越被应用于各种场景。在事件驱动编程中,我们可以将业务数据看作一系列事件的集合,通过建立事件机制来驱动整个系统的业务流程。ThinkPHP6作为一款流行的PHP框架,也支持事件驱动编程。下面我们就来介绍一下如何利用ThinkPHP6实现事件驱动编程。一、Think
    ThinkPHP 编程 事件驱动
    167 2024-03-26
  • 如何利用Redis和Haskell实现事件驱动的应用功能
    如何利用Redis和Haskell实现事件驱动的应用功能
    如何利用Redis和Haskell实现事件驱动的应用功能引言:Redis是一个高性能的键值存储系统,常用于缓存、消息队列、实时计算等场景。Haskell是一种强类型的函数式编程语言,拥有高度的表达能力和强大的类型系统。Redis和Haskell的结合可以提供一种高效、可靠的事件驱动编程模型,该模型在
    Redis Haskell 事件驱动
    267 2023-10-13
  • Golang与RabbitMQ实现事件驱动的大规模数据处理系统
    Golang与RabbitMQ实现事件驱动的大规模数据处理系统
    Golang与RabbitMQ实现事件驱动的大规模数据处理系统摘要:在当今大数据时代,处理大规模数据已经成为了许多企业的需求。为了有效地处理这些数据,事件驱动的架构模式变得越来越流行。Golang作为一种高效、可靠的编程语言,和RabbitMQ作为一个可靠的消息队列系统,可以被用来搭建一个高效的事件
    RabbitMQ golang 事件驱动
    310 2023-09-28
  • Golang中使用RabbitMQ实现事件驱动的架构设计
    Golang中使用RabbitMQ实现事件驱动的架构设计
    Golang中使用RabbitMQ实现事件驱动的架构设计引言:随着互联网的不断发展,各种规模的应用程序需求越来越复杂。传统的单体应用逐渐不能满足需求,分布式架构成为了趋势。在分布式架构中,事件驱动的架构设计模式被广泛采用,它能够解耦各个组件之间的依赖关系,提高系统的可伸缩性、可扩展性和可靠性。本文将
    RabbitMQ golang 事件驱动
    106 2023-09-27
  • Golang与RabbitMQ实现事件驱动的大规模数据处理系统的设计与实现
    Golang与RabbitMQ实现事件驱动的大规模数据处理系统的设计与实现
    Golang与RabbitMQ实现事件驱动的大规模数据处理系统的设计与实现前言:随着大数据时代的到来,处理海量数据成为许多企业所面临的挑战。为了高效处理这些数据,常常需要采用事件驱动的架构来构建数据处理系统。本文介绍了如何使用Golang与RabbitMQ来设计和实现一个事件驱动的大规模数据处理系统
    RabbitMQ golang 事件驱动
    224 2023-09-27
  • 如何在PHP微服务中实现分布式事件驱动和触发
    如何在PHP微服务中实现分布式事件驱动和触发
    如何在PHP微服务中实现分布式事件驱动和触发随着云计算和微服务架构的流行,分布式系统已成为许多大型应用程序的标配。在分布式系统中,事件驱动架构成为一种常见的设计模式,用于解耦服务之间的依赖关系,提高系统的可伸缩性和可维护性。在本文中,我们将探讨如何在PHP微服务中实现分布式事件驱动和触发,并提供具体
    php 微服务 分布式 事件驱动 触发
    372 2023-09-25
  • 使用Java编写的微服务消息总线与事件驱动工具
    使用Java编写的微服务消息总线与事件驱动工具
    使用Java编写的微服务消息总线与事件驱动工具在现代的软件架构中,微服务架构已经成为一种常见的设计模式。微服务架构的核心理念是将整个应用拆分成一系列小型、自治的服务,每个服务都拥有自己的独立数据库,并通过网络通信协议进行通信。这种架构具有高度的可伸缩性、可维护性和可测试性。然而,由于微服务之间的通信
    微服务 事件驱动 Java编写
    181 2023-08-08
  • 优化Python网站访问速度,使用非阻塞IO和事件驱动的编程技巧。
    优化Python网站访问速度,使用非阻塞IO和事件驱动的编程技巧。
    优化Python网站访问速度,使用非阻塞IO和事件驱动的编程技巧简介:随着互联网的发展,网站的访问速度对用户体验起着至关重要的作用。而Python作为一门高级的脚本语言,其在网络编程方面充满优势。本文将通过使用非阻塞IO和事件驱动的编程技巧,来优化Python网站的访问速度,提升用户体验。非阻塞IO
    事件驱动 优化速度 非阻塞IO
    450 2023-08-04
  • Symfony框架中间件:实现可靠的事件驱动编程
    Symfony框架中间件:实现可靠的事件驱动编程
    Symfony框架中间件:实现可靠的事件驱动编程在当今的软件开发中,事件驱动编程成为了一种非常流行的开发模式。它通过在系统中定义事件和监听器,实现了组件之间的松耦合,并能够在特定的事件发生时执行相应的操作。Symfony框架作为PHP最受欢迎的开发框架之一,提供了一种强大的机制来实现可靠的事件驱动编
    Symfony 中间件 事件驱动
    312 2023-07-29
  • PHP和MQTT:构建基于事件驱动的实时数据分析系统
    PHP和MQTT:构建基于事件驱动的实时数据分析系统
    PHP和MQTT:构建基于事件驱动的实时数据分析系统在当今的数字时代,实时数据分析成为了企业决策和业务优化的关键。为了实现高效的实时数据分析,需要一个可靠而灵活的系统来收集、处理和存储数据。在本文中,我们将介绍如何使用PHP和MQTT (Message Queuing Telemetry Trans
    php MQTT 事件驱动
    209 2023-07-08
  • 如何使用Java编写一个可伸缩的事件驱动应用程序
    如何使用Java编写一个可伸缩的事件驱动应用程序
    随着数字化时代的发展,云计算和大数据技术被广泛应用,开发能够满足高性能和可伸缩性的软件变得越来越重要。本文介绍如何使用Java编写一个可伸缩的事件驱动应用程序来满足这个需求。事件驱动应用程序是指在程序中事先定义好的事件发生后会触发一系列的操作,这种方式适合处理多个客户端同时发生的请求,例如网络服务器
    java 事件驱动 伸缩性
    291 2023-06-28
  • PHP中的高性能事件驱动框架及其应用
    PHP中的高性能事件驱动框架及其应用
    随着Web应用程序的快速发展,处理高访问量和高并发请求的能力变得越来越关键。为了确保PHP应用程序具有高性能和可伸缩性,开发人员需要使用高性能事件驱动框架。在本文章中,我们将介绍PHP中的高性能事件驱动框架,包括其工作原理、特点以及应用场景。一、什么是高性能事件驱动框架?高性能事件驱动框架是指一种基
    php 事件驱动 高性能框架
    278 2023-06-25
  • PHP中的事件驱动编程及其相关函数
    PHP中的事件驱动编程及其相关函数
    PHP中的事件驱动编程及其相关函数随着互联网和移动互联网的发展,对Web应用程序的需求越来越多样化和复杂化。传统的PHP应用程序采用了基于请求响应的模式,聚焦于响应每一个HTTP请求,但是这种模式缺少灵活性,难以处理一些高并发、复杂和实时的业务场景。而事件驱动编程(Event Driven Prog
    PHP函数 事件驱动 相关函数
    439 2023-06-23